| | | | | -------------------------------------- | | ------------- | | template< class T > struct is_union; | | (since C++11) |

std::is_union is a UnaryTypeTrait.

Checks whether T is a union type. Provides the member constant value, which is equal to true if T is a union type. Otherwise, value is equal to false.

If the program adds specializations for std::is_union or std::is_union_v, the behavior is undefined.

[edit] Helper variable template

| template< class T > constexpr bool is_union_v = is_union<T>::value; | | (since C++17) | | ------------------------------------------------------------------------- | | ------------- |
